‘Blissful’: Heathrow airport standstill brings rare silence to nearby villages

Residents of areas under airport’s flightpath savour a brief taste of ‘peace and tranquillity’ amid travel chaos

  • Heathrow airport closure – live updates

Chirping birds and unbroken skies come as standard in many English villages, though not in Harmondsworth – which lies under Heathrow’s flight path. But Friday was different.

“It’s been peace and tranquillity,” said 72-year-old Andrew Melville, who has lived in the village, which straddles the border of London and Berkshire, for 49 years. “Especially not being woken up by transatlantic flights in the early morning.”
